Acclaimed actor Billy Bob Thornton was recently sighted in a New Jersey suburb filming an upcoming film.
Thornton, 70, was spotted Monday in Cranford on the set of an upcoming movie titled “Somedays,” according to TAPinto.
The Oscar-winning actor will star alongside Ariana Greenblatt in the film which is expected to be released in early 2027. Brian Klugman is writing and directing the project.
Thornton was seen dressed as a delivery driver in a parking lot along Miln Street.

“Somedays” is a movie about a terminally ill delivery driver (Thornton) who befriends a troubled teenage girl (Greenblatt) after saving her, forming a life-changing bond.
Thornton, who currently stars in the Paramount+ series “Landman‚” is famous for his roles in films such as “Bad Santa,” “Armageddon” and “Monster’s Ball.”
Greenblatt has appeared in projects like “Now You See Me: Now You Don’t,” “Barbie” and “Avengers: Infinity War.”
New Jersey has become a hotbed for shooting film and television projects recently. Adam Sandler, who filmed “Happy Gilmore 2″ throughout New Jersey, shot another Netflix project in Cranford last summer.
Bob Dylan biopic “A Complete Unknown,” was shot in the Garden State. Other upcoming star-studded Netflix films like “The Whisper Man” and “Here Comes the Flood” have also been seen shooting in New Jersey.
Even more Hollywood activity is expected to come to New Jersey as Netflix is building a massive studio in Oceanport.
